Bain name meaning

name meaning: Bain \bain\ as a boy's name is a variant of Bainbridge (Irish, Gaelic), and the meaning of Bain is "pale bridge".

The baby name Bain sounds like Ban and Pain. Other similar baby names are Bail, Blain, Brain, Cain, Kain, Dain, Fain, Iain, Rain, Wain and Zain.

origin:  Irish
number of letters: 4.